To avoid any impact on the environment or human health due to dangerous 
substances present in electrical and electronic devices, the end users of such devices 
are expected to understand the meaning of the symbol consisting of a crossed-out 
waste container. Do not dispose of electrical and electronic equipment along with 
unsorted household waste. Instead, dispose of it separately and properly.

The packaging that protects the device against transport damage is made from 
non-polluting materials that can be disposed of via local recycle bins.

This device complies with part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the 
following two conditions: (1) This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) 
this device must accept any interference received, including interference that may 

cause undesired operation.

This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ital 
device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able 
protection against harmful interference in a residential installation. This equipment generates, 
uses and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with 
the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io communications. However, there 
is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ment 
does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by 
tur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by 
one or more of the following measures:

•  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
•  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
•  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that to which the receiver 

is connected.

•  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.

CAUTION!

 This symbol highlights dangerous situations which may lead to minor to 

moderate injuries, damage, malfunction and/or destruction of the device.

To prevent harm or damage from happening to users or others, make sure to comply 
with the following requirements.

•  Always check the device for visible external damage before use. Do not use the device in 

case of damage.

•  Never open the device or attempt to carry out any repairs yourself.
•  Do not allow any liquids or moisture to enter the device.
•  Never subject the device to extreme heat or humidity, especially when storing it in a car. 

If the car is stationary for a longer time in hot weather, exposed to direct sunlight, high 
temperatures can occur in the car interior. In such a case, electrical and electronic devices 
are best removed from the vehicle.

•  Whenever detecting a burning smell or smoke coming from the charger, immediately 

disconnect it from the auxiliary power outlet.
